API 512c 500 Series Microphone/Line Preamplifier Features: Mic Preamp with 65dB of gain Front and Back Panel Mic Input Access Line/Instrument Preamp with 50dB of gain Front and Back Panel Line/Instrument Input LED VU meter for monitoring output level 20dB pad switch, applies to mic/line/instrument 48v Phantom switchable power Traditional API fully discrete circuit design Uses the famous API 2520 Op-amp API 512C 500 Series Microphone/Line Preamplifier Specifications Rear Connector:Output on edge connector, MIC Input on edge connector, can be defeated Front Connectors:XLR MIC Input, hi-Z 1/4" Unbal Input Gain Range:MIC, 10 dB min, 65 dB max. Unbal HI-Z Input, 14 dB min, 50 dB max Maximum Input Levels:MIC, +8 dBu, Unbal HI-Z Input, +36 dBu Input Impedance:MIC Input, 1500 Ohms (150 Ohm mic), HI-Z Unbal Input, 20 K Ohms Output Impedance:Less than 75 Ohms, Transformer Balanced Clipping Level:+30dBu Frequency Response:+0, -.3, 30Hz to 20kHz Equivalent Input Noise: -129, Mic In. -125, Un-Balanced In. Actual Metered Noise: Mic, -95 dBu, Un-Bal., -90 dBu Distortion:Less than .05% at +4 Out, Less than .1% at +28 Out Size:1.50" X 5.25" X 6" Deep Weight:1 lb. 7 oz. The API 500-6B is a 6-slot Lunchbox chassis for holding up to 6 API standard-format modules. With it, you can develop your own custom rig of API gear, mixing and matching API's first-class modular preamp, EQ, and compressor selection. The API 500-6B features a 48-volt internal phantom power supply and is self-powered. It's got a rugged steel chassis, rubber feet, and a sturdy carrying handle, so it's portable enough to take with you and set up. Get ready for classic API sound and load up with the API 500-6B. API 500-6B 6-slot Chassis for API Modules Features: Holds 6 API standard modules 215mA per slot DB-25 connectors for easy input and output connection XLRs to access channels 7 and 8 of the multipins Power rail LED indication Self-Powered, 100 to 250 Volts switchable, 47 to 63Hz Rubber feet & carrying handle for portability Rugged steel chassis Perfect for remote recording of Vocalist and Instruments The API 500-6B is a 6-slot Lunchbox chassis, ready to be loaded with API modules! Quality Gear From API In 1968, Automated Processes Inc. began building quality consoles for broadcast applications. Soon, the company's products found favor with recording studios, and a string of industry-leading advancements (including computerized console automation, the first VCA, and more) followed. API produced the 2520 amplifier, one of the most famous op-amps in the recording industry, and their consoles and products found homes in such iconic studio facilities as Ocean Way, the Record Plant, and Sunset Sound, among others. In fact, there are over 700 classic API consoles around the globe — many of which are still in use.
